“I absolutely love this pattern. I was looking for a toile aesthetic without any of the typical pastoral characters; and this fairy and mushroom design was perfect. For my plaster wall, freshly painted with a custom color to match the matte backing of the wallpaper, I ordered the glissade in Eggshell and Carolina. It was especially nice that this pattern repeats at the edge perfectly with no need to keep multiple panels in a specific order - they are exactly the same, no matter how many you use. I also liked how sturdy the paper was; it did not rip easily or crinkle or pick up lots of lint/hair as I worked with it. Actually, I needed to bear down pretty hard with my new exact-o knife blade to cut off the top/bottom edges when a panel was complete. Made me feel like I couldn't hurt anything in the process and could really push this wallpaper around. The tutorials do not explain WHY you want to leave an inch at the top of the wall instead of simply starting with the already straight edge, but I figured it allows for if the ceiling is not straight all the way across. I decided to just trust the process of loosely taping a panel in place, with an inch allowance at the ceiling, and got myself a spray bottle and a ladder. The brayer included in the materials is all I needed for smoothing the panels down perfectly (as long as they were properly wet on the back). Some helpful additions were a work lamp creating raking light to reveal any bumps I missed in the first passes, a damp cloth to wipe off excess glue, and a towel on the floor to catch all the spraying/dripping water needed to activate the glue. A second person to hold the panel rolled up and keep it from getting wet all the way down as you're trying to secure the top is invaluable, too. There was one panel where I mistakenly left several dry spots right in the middle, making little proud air pockets off the wall, so I was able to test how easily the panels can be removed when I needed to peel it back and correct the mistake. More water under the edges and a little extra waiting time for saturation but then the paper came off with no rips and was still not too soggy to be adhered a second time. The product is very much as advertised when it comes to ease of application and removal. It has taken me four months to do a 12 foot wall (one 2 foot panel a day when I had the time and energy), but now that I'm finished, I am overjoyed with the look! 3 Huge Benefits Neutral Wallpaper Colors Bring To Interior Design
Versatility and Timelessness
Neutral wallpaper will not interfere with the decor of the room, whether it is a modern minimalistic interior, or a traditional one. This is because while bold or trendy colors might look great for now, they might not stand the test of time like neutrals do. You can use them to try out different furniture and pop of colors as accents without overwhelming the space and making it look busy.
Enhances Natural Light
Lighter neutral shades of white, cream, and light grey enhance the reflection of natural light making places look and feel bigger and brighter. It is very useful for small apartments, rooms with minimal windows, or really any small spaces to make them look and feel more airy and open.
Increases Home Value
A neutral color palette is a good investment for homeowners, because it is appealing to a wide audience. Neutral wallpaper is a godsend when you ever plan to sell your home, as it makes staging and decorating easy, resulting in a universally appealing aesthetic that potential buyers adore. This will save you time and money as you don't have to do any last minute updates to bring your home into the current century.
Common Questions About Peel and Stick Neutral Wallpaper
What shades are considered "neutral"?
Neutral shades include beige, taupe, gray, cream, white, greige (a mix of gray and beige), and soft earthy tones like sand and muted clay. These colors provide a versatile and calming backdrop that complements a variety of decor styles.
How well does neutral wallpaper hold up to light?
Neutral wallpaper, especially lighter shades, reflects natural and artificial light, making spaces appear brighter and more open. As all of Love vs. Design are printed with non toxic UV gel which is fade resistant.
How can I add visual interest to a room with neutral wallpaper?
You can enhance a neutral wallpapered space by incorporating textured designs, subtle patterns, or layering different shades of neutral tones. Adding contrasting furniture, metallic accents, statement lighting, or artwork can also create depth and character.
Will a light neutral wallpaper show wall imperfections?
Yes, lighter shades of neutral wallpaper can sometimes highlight wall imperfections. To minimize this, choose textured wallpaper, thicker materials, or apply a smooth primer to the wall before installation. Patterns or subtle prints can also help disguise minor flaws.
